From 4464e134eae415c47c437393073411c26d64bd4a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Peter Geoghegan Date: Tue, 3 Apr 2018 10:25:41 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Fix GCC 7 snprintf() compiler warning. Make buffer 1 byte larger to fit a sign. It's actually impossible for there to be a sign in practice, but this is still required to keep GCC 7 happy. Cleanup from commit 51bc271790eb234a1ba4d14d3e6530f70de92ab5. Based on a suggestion from Peter Eisentraut.
